I've been hooked on Maine Beer Co. They make small batches that you can find on draft if you are in the Portland area or Eastern Standard in Boston or the 16ish oz. bottles. Mean Old Tom is a nice Oatmeal Stout with some vanillia used, but by no means overpowering. A nice drinkable stout that won't overwhelm with alcohol % like some of the imperials that are out there. They make a few others Zoe, Peeper, and Lunch that are all excellent. If you ever see the Lunch IPA I would grab as much as you can. Its developing a cultish following and doesnt last long. Its one of the best IPA's I've ever had and thats my favorite style.
